SureChill is a pioneering platform cooling technology that continuously cools for weeks without power. It is innovative and its performance is unrivalled. By harnessing the unique properties of water, it allows continual cooling at a perfect 4ºC, anywhere in the world. The technology is saving lives today, and it can help save our planet. Vaccine Refrigerators powered by SureChill technology were first launched into the medical market in 2011, far exceeding the most stringent standards set by the World Health Organization. Today, they’re purchased by the likes of UNICEF, saving lives in 46 countries by protecting vaccines. It has been commended for aiding vaccine delivery in developing countries, and received a $1.5 million ‘Grand Challenges’ award from the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ation to improve the vaccine cold chain. SureChill is a technology with no boundaries, disrupting the entire cooling industry, with the potential to revolutionise the way that we all cool in our homes and everywhere else cooling is required. In 2018, Nigel Saunders (CEO) accompanied the then-Prime Minister Theresa May to Kenya as part of her tour of Africa. In 2019, Sure Chill received a further £4m investment from The Garage Soho and Novastar Venture.
